Why Table Games Are Back in the Spotlight

Table games have always held a strong place in the US casino market, but recent player behavior shows a growing interest in titles that feel more skill-based and less automated than slots. Blackjack remains a top choice for low-house-edge play, roulette continues to attract casual players, and live dealer tables keep gaining traction among users who want a more social format.

That trend is especially relevant as more casino brands fine-tune welcome packages. A large bonus may look appealing at first glance, but if it applies only to slots, table game players may not get the same practical benefit. For anyone comparing brands, that makes the fine print just as important as the headline percentage.

The Fine Print That Could Affect Real Value

For sweepstakes-style casino users, the most important rule is often the playthrough requirement. At DollarTornado, bonus Sweeps Coins carry a 1x playthrough before moving from the promotional balance to the redeemable balance. On paper, that is lighter than many traditional online casino rollover rules, but it still matters where those coins can actually be used.

There are also state restrictions to keep in mind. The platform is available in the United States, excluding Connecticut, Idaho, Kentucky, Michigan, and Montana. KYC verification is required before any redemption, and most players face a redemption cap of $10,000 per day, while Florida players are limited to $5,000 per day.

A Smarter Way to Judge Table Game Offers

For readers tracking the table games category, the main lesson is simple: not every large welcome offer is built with table game play in mind. A 270% boost sounds aggressive, but Gold Coins are for entertainment only and cannot be redeemed. If your focus is on potential real redemption value through Sweeps Coins, then eligible game lists become the real headline.

That is why experienced players tend to compare more than bonus size. They look at whether blackjack, roulette, craps, or live dealer titles count toward requirements, how quickly bonus funds can convert, and whether there are restrictions that make a promotion less useful in practice.
